4-((carbobenzyloxy)amino)phenacyl dibenzyl phosphate (ethylene ketal)

Base Information
  • Chemical Name:4-((carbobenzyloxy)amino)phenacyl dibenzyl phosphate (ethylene ketal)
  • CAS No.:188119-62-2
  • Molecular Formula:C32H32NO8P
  • Molecular Weight:589.582

synthetic route:
Guidance literature:
Multi-step reaction with 3 steps
1: 93 percent / Br2; AlCl3 / tetrahydrofuran / 40 h / 0 °C
2: 89 percent / benzene / 2 h / Heating
3: 96 percent / p-toluenesulfonic acid / benzene / 24 h / Heating
With aluminium trichloride; bromine; toluene-4-sulfonic acid; In tetrahydrofuran; benzene; 1: Bromination / 2: Esterification / 3: Condensation;
DOI:10.1021/ja9635589
